Police release names of three slain Canadian Mounties
Published in Saudi Press Agency on 06 - 06 - 2014

Police on Friday released the names of three Royal Canadian Mounted Police (RCMP) officers killed by a lone gunman who
led law enforcement on a 30-hour manhunt before surrendering, dpa reported.
The killing of the three RCMP officers, often referred to as
Mounties, shocked the small community of 70,000 residents in the
eastern town of Moncton, where crime rates are so low that many
people don't lock their doors.
It also led to an outpouring of public support for the police. An
impromptu memorial sprang up on the steps of the RCMP detachment in
Moncton, with dozens of people stopping by to pay their respects.
"This is a trying time for our members as we have lost three of our
own and two more are hospitalized," New Brunswick RCMP Assistant
Commissioner Roger Brown said.
The officers were identified as David Ross, 32; Fabrice Georges
Gevaudan, 45; and Douglas James Larche, 40.
Two other officers who were injured, were recovering after undergoing
surgery on Thursday, officials said.
The Mounties were gunned down Wednesday evening while responding to a
call about a heavily armed man dressed in camouflage.
Police say Justin Bourque, the 24-year-old suspect, was a gun
enthusiast who wanted to "go out with a bang and take people with
him," local media reported Friday.
Bourque was arrested by an elite RCMP tactical team at about 12:10 am
(0310 GMT) after an all-day manhunt that paralysed the town of
Moncton on Thursday, forcing the closure of government offices,
schools, libraries and the zoo.
The public had been told to stay indoors with the doors locked.
